University of Illinois Urbana-Champaign – Department of Computer Science

Website | Scholarships & Financial Aid

The University of Illinois at Urbana-Champaign (UIUC) is a top-tier institution for information technology studies. The Department of Computer Science offers a comprehensive undergraduate and graduate curriculum in fields such as computer science, data science, artificial intelligence, and software engineering.

UIUC is well-known for its research-driven approach and innovation in IT, with cutting-edge labs and a strong emphasis on hands-on learning. The university’s partnerships with tech giants like Google and Microsoft allow students to gain real-world experience and expand their professional networks.

UIUC offers numerous scholarships and financial aid options, including merit-based awards, need-based aid, and department-specific scholarships to ensure students can afford their education.


Northwestern University – McCormick School of Engineering and Applied Science

Website | Scholarships & Financial Aid

Northwestern University’s McCormick School of Engineering and Applied Science offers an outstanding program in computer science and IT-related fields. Students can major in computer science, computer engineering, and electrical engineering, with opportunities to explore emerging areas like artificial intelligence, cybersecurity, and machine learning.

McCormick emphasizes interdisciplinary learning, which means students often collaborate with peers from other departments such as business, law, and communications to solve complex problems. The school also offers a range of internship and co-op programs, connecting students with top IT companies in Chicago and beyond.

Financial aid options at Northwestern include merit scholarships, need-based financial aid, and grants, making this prestigious institution more accessible for students from diverse financial backgrounds.


Illinois Institute of Technology – Department of Computer Science

Website | Scholarships & Financial Aid

The Illinois Institute of Technology (IIT) offers a robust computer science program within its College of Engineering. Students can pursue undergraduate and graduate degrees in computer science, with specializations in cybersecurity, software engineering, artificial intelligence, and computer networks.

IIT’s curriculum is designed to be highly practical, with strong industry ties that provide students with internship, co-op, and job placement opportunities. The university also places a heavy emphasis on research, with state-of-the-art labs and opportunities for students to engage in groundbreaking IT projects.

IIT provides various financial aid options, including merit-based scholarships, need-based assistance, and graduate assistantships to support students financially throughout their studies.

Southern Illinois University Carbondale – College of Engineering

Website | Scholarships & Financial Aid

Southern Illinois University Carbondale (SIUC) offers a strong program in computer science and IT, with a focus on software engineering, cybersecurity, and networking. SIUC’s curriculum emphasizes practical experience, providing students with opportunities to work on real-world IT projects through internships and co-ops.

SIUC is also home to the Center for Cybersecurity, where students can engage in cutting-edge research in this rapidly evolving field. The university’s smaller size allows for a more personalized educational experience, with faculty providing close mentorship and career guidance.

The university offers a range of scholarships and financial aid options, including merit-based and need-based scholarships, to help reduce the financial burden for students.
